Take Me Back To Another Time

Who Can Do It

We suggest this project is done by students between the age of 8 and 15. This is an individual project and can be done at home or by individuals in a classroom situation. This is the historical equivalent of the "If I'd Been Born Somewhere Else" project.

What You'll Need

You will need access to a word processing package and, possibly, a scanner.

How To Do It

With this project we want you to use your imagination, plus check out some facts, and think what your life would have been like if you had lived in a different time period in England. You can use our “Times Past” section, here, to select a time period.

Then you can use some of the info on the timeline, hoots and story pages for that period to think about what life may have been like and do some more research yourself.

We would like your completed project to cover the following sections.

facts
Why did you choose this period?
What do you think you would have liked about this period?
What do you think you would have disliked about this period?
What one invention from the present would you have wanted to take back to this period? How do you think it might have changed lives?
Using the five topics that Owlbut covers in his hoots section, Homes, Clothes. Food. Daily Life and Culture, give us a brief description of your life.

All of the above should be written up in a report of between 1,000 and 1,500 words.
